HW 200 - Nutrition for Life

2.00 credits.
The goal of this course is for students to develop a better understanding of nutrition and how to create healthy choices based on their specific dietary needs.  Students will learn about food energy sources (carbs, proteins and fats), macronutrients, micronutrients, and developing a meal plan/grocery list.  Specific diets will be introduced (gluten free, lactose free, vegetarian, vegan, etc.), as well as pro and con discussions of popular and fad diets.  Students will learn how nutrition can affect their health by learning about several comorbidities and how proper nutrition has been proven to prevent and/or decrease complications.    Students who have taken the BIO 200 Nutrition course are prohibited from taking HW 200.  In addition, this course does not fulfill requirements in the natural or physical sciences.
